Transaction 615412621ed7a94b098c58898f42ddf107a692c2343c788544997cfc2fcf9896

2 Input
2 Outputs
  • 615412621ed7a94b098c58898f42ddf107a692c2343c788544997cfc2fcf9896:0
  • value  25806
    address  2N8LUoZUTLUMu9v5kdfBpYjTdZhN9kXWfxf
  • 615412621ed7a94b098c58898f42ddf107a692c2343c788544997cfc2fcf9896:1
  • value  1000690
    address  2MxBqNFXm5VNcXP5v67q4Afi43eMH1inkCp